Output 3dca174b6054d93f88cb8ef41aaddf1ba731f27a36ebf4f2062feedc19b3bbd9:0

value
38729630
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a71cc5865d7d7b71b7841ce911d3fd6d55dce4bc OP_EQUAL
address
3GvdEfTpmmk7xWuWLb6FgFwzkG3GBusXZw
transaction
3dca174b6054d93f88cb8ef41aaddf1ba731f27a36ebf4f2062feedc19b3bbd9
confirmations
256816
spent
true